Data Science Folder Structure Setup

  1. This was developed for creating a Python folder to start a data science project.

  2. It includes preconfigured connections to different systems:

    • uv
    • git
    • GitHub workflow
    • .gitignore
  3. It also provides small code snippets for connecting to other systems.

  4. Below are some of the systems included, along with additional setup steps to get them working:

    • logging
    • SQL
    • src
    • config
    • pre-commit hook
    • .gitignore
    • git
    • GitHub workflow
    • uv
    • env
    • validation
    • testing
    • requirements.txt
      • Install dependencies with: uv install requirements.txt
  5. Install the package:

    pip install datascience-folder-structure
    
  6. Create a folder structure:

    createdatasciencefolder NameOfProject
